It's hard to say exactly why do they do it but, according to some sources, bears probably play to practice fighting or hunting skills, increase cardiovascular fitness and "burn off" excess energy. It is also a great way to test strengthen their social bonds by reducing aggression, enhancing alliances, increasing tolerance, and improving group cohesion. Not to mention, the release of endorphins and other "feel good" chemicals - just like humans enjoy playing maybe they feel the same kind of joy. Well-fed cubs play more than malnourished ones. Keeping that in mind, it is pretty evident that these bears don't lack in food. It is important to say that, unlike children, bears play without vocalizing. It can sometimes be confused with fighting but fighting is noisy and if there is no noise it is a good sign that they are just playing.

Cat hilariously kneads the air and his leg
Kneading is an activity common to all domestic cats but Jeremy the Ragdoll has taken it to another level. Usually, cats knead blanket, the owner or even some plush toy but Jeremy kneads the air and his leg, without even realizing what he is doing. Adorable and so cute!
Kneading is an activity where cats alternately push out and pull in their front paws, often alternating between right and left limbs. Kneading is often a precursor to sleeping, and we can see Jeremy doing precisely that. He is kneading his way to sleep. He is so sleepy and in need of some kneading that he just didn't want to get up to find something commonly accepted for kneading. In the situations like this, Jeremy doesn't hesitate to knead his leg or even the air itself. Kneading may have an origin going back to cats' wild ancestors who had to tread down grass or foliage to make a temporary nest in which to rest. Alternatively, the behavior may be a remnant of a newborn's kneading of the mother's teat to stimulate milk secretion. Some experts consider kneading to "stimulate" the cat and make it feel right, in the same manner as a human stretching. The cat exerts firm downwards pressure with its paw, opening its toes to expose its claws, then closes its claws as it lifts its leg. The process takes place with alternate paws at intervals of one to two seconds. They may do this while sitting on their owner's lap, which may prove painful if the cat is large or strong or has sharp claws (as the claws tend to dig into one's lap).
Although cats mainly knead as kittens, sometimes the behavior continues into adult life, and as you can see, Jeremy is a full grown cat that is not ashamed of this "kittens" behavior. That's right Jeremy; you should never forget your inner kitten!

Cats in general sleep a lot. It is, arguably, their most known characteristic. But, nevertheless, it comes as a surprise to realize just how much is that. According to some sources, cats usually sleep between 12 and 16 hours, with 13 and 14 being the average and some cats can sleep as much as 20 hours! Fluffy Cat in a Cutest Shadow Play Theatre
We are sure you all know how shadows are formed and that with a little bit of imagination you can have a fun with them. So let us present you Jeremy the Ragdoll cat. He’s a fluffy little boy who can't get enough of his fatherly teaser wand. But to make things little different, his owners decided to present his play through the art of shadow performance also known as shadow play. Shadow play is an ancient form of storytelling and entertainment where figures are held between a source of light and a screen. Here, you can see a real Cat playing in the cutes Shadow play technic. Jeremy the Ragdoll is the great hunter (and his shadow as well). So let us tell you a bit more about this oldest form of puppetry in the world. It is known as the precursor to modern movies and it takes a true mastery to make puppets come alive under a lamp light. The story of shadow play dramas have a long history and some say it’s over 2000 years old. According to one beautiful legend, it first originated during the Han Dynasty. The legend said that Emperor Wu became devastated, inconsolable and completely heartbroken after his favorite young concubine had died. He ignored all the affairs of the state and ordered his officers to find a way to bring his beloved back to life. Unable to fulfill their emperor’s demands, officers had the idea to recreate the shape of passed concubine using leather pieces and painted clothes. Using an oil lamp, they could make her shadow move, thus bringing her back to life. After seeing the shadow play, Emperor Wu and his heart began to recover. This love story is recorded in the book titled, “The History of the Han Dynasty.”
